Doorknob repair services involve fixing or replacing damaged or malfunctioning door hardware to ensure proper operation and security. Over time, door knobs can become loose, sticky, or difficult to turn, making it hard to open or close doors smoothly. Service providers can address issues such as broken latches, misaligned knobs, or worn-out components that prevent the door from functioning correctly. Whether a knob is simply loose or completely broken, professional repair can restore the door’s usability without the need for full replacement.

This service helps solve a variety of common problems homeowners encounter with door hardware. For example, a door knob that no longer turns or latches properly can compromise security and convenience. Some knobs may become squeaky or difficult to operate due to internal wear or debris. In other cases, the latch mechanism may stick or fail to engage fully, leaving doors unsecured. Local contractors can diagnose the underlying issue and perform repairs that improve both the safety and functionality of interior and exterior doors.

The overview below groups typical Doorknob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or doorknob repairs, such as fixing a loose or sticking knob, usually range from $50 to $150.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, with fewer projects reaching the lower or higher ends.

Hardware Replacement - Replacing a doorknob or lockset generally costs between $100 and $300, depending on the style and quality of the hardware. Most projects stay within this range, though custom or high-end hardware can push costs higher.

Full Doorknob Replacement - When replacing multiple doorknobs or upgrading entire doors, costs typically range from $250 to $600 for many smaller jobs. Larger, more complex projects can reach $1,000 or more, especially if additional work is needed.

Complete Door Replacements - For extensive repairs involving door replacement along with hardware, costs can vary widely from $1,000 to $5,000 or more. Most projects fall into the lower to mid-range, with high-end or custom doors at the top end.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of doorknob repairs do local contractors handle? Local service providers can fix a variety of doorknob issues, including loose knobs, broken latches, misalignment, and faulty locking mechanisms.

Can doorknob repair improve security? Yes, repairing or replacing damaged doorknobs can enhance the security of your doors by ensuring locks function properly and are reliable.

Is doorknob repair suitable for all door types? Many local contractors have experience repairing doorknobs on different door materials such as wood, metal, or composite, making repairs suitable for most door types.

What signs indicate a doorknob needs repair? Common signs include difficulty turning the knob, a loose or wobbly handle, a latch that doesn’t catch, or a lock that won’t engage properly.

How do local service providers handle doorknob repairs? They typically assess the issue, determine whether repair or replacement is needed, and then perform the necessary work to restore proper function and security.
